About the project

Petra Medica is a healthcare provider offering a wide range of medical services, including primary and specialist care, diagnostics, and mental health support. The previous website (petramedica.pl) was outdated, with a cluttered interface and limited functionality, making it difficult for patients to access essential information and services. Our goal was to create a modern, user-friendly website (petramedica.muchmore.dev) that enhances user experience, improves accessibility, and reflects the professionalism of Petra Medica.​

Problem statement

The existing Petra Medica website had become outdated and no longer reflected the professionalism or quality of its medical services. The design lacked structure, the navigation was confusing, and finding key information — such as services or appointment options — required effort and patience from users.

On top of that, the site was not optimized for mobile devices, which severely limited accessibility for patients browsing on the go. One of the most pressing issues was the limited ability for users to book appointments online or access up-to-date service information easily. These limitations created friction in the user journey and weakened Petra Medica’s digital presence in a competitive space.

Design strategy

We approached the redesign by putting patients at the center of the process. Using a user-centered design methodology, we mapped the needs, frustrations, and behaviors of Petra Medica's typical users and aligned the structure of the new site around their goals.

Visually, we introduced a modern and professional aesthetic that reflected Petra Medica’s reliability and brand identity. Ensuring full responsiveness was a priority — the new site needed to be just as usable on mobile devices as on desktop.

We also worked to enhance functionality, particularly around appointment booking and access to service-related content. The goal was to make every interaction feel seamless, whether a patient was browsing available services, learning about a doctor, or trying to book an appointment.

Proposed solutions

The new site began with a reimagined homepage, built to guide users toward services and actions with clear visual hierarchy and compelling calls-to-action.

We created detailed service pages that provided patients with everything they needed to understand each offering and how to access it — no more hunting through unrelated sections. Each doctor profile was crafted to include qualifications, areas of expertise, and a personal introduction, helping build trust between patients and practitioners.

To further improve user clarity, we added a structured facility information section, detailing each location’s services, opening hours, and contact points. A news and updates section was also introduced, offering health tips and announcements to keep patients engaged beyond their appointments.
